Install Mysql Database Centos 7

Install Mysql Database on Centos 7

MySQL is a popular choice of database for use in web applications, and is a central component of the widely used LAMP open source web application software stack (and other 'AMP' stacks). LAMP is an acronym for "Linux, Apache, MySQL, Perl/PHP/Python." Free-software-open source projects that require a full-featured database management system often use MySQL.

Not yet in the repos list, so I had to download the lastest MySQL yum repo for mysql from http://dev.mysql.com/downloads/repo/yum/

At the time of this article it was mysql-community-release-el7-5.noarch.rpm

Install MySQL repo

You can download that from our server

wget http://briansnelson.com/stuff/mysql-community-release-el7-5.noarch.rpm
yum localinstall mysql-community-release-el7-5.noarch.rpm

Install MySQL via Yum

yum install mysql-server mysql

Enable MySQL to start on boot

systemctl enable mysqld.service

You should see something like the following:

ln -s '/usr/lib/systemd/system/mysqld.service' '/etc/systemd/system/mysql.service'
ln -s '/usr/lib/systemd/system/mysqld.service' '/etc/systemd/system/multi-user.target.wants/mysqld.service'

Disable MySqL from start on boot

systemctl disable mysqld.service

You should see something like the following:

rm '/etc/systemd/system/multi-user.target.wants/mysqld.service'
rm '/etc/systemd/system/mysql.service'

Start/Stop/Restart MySQL

Start

systemctl start mysqld.service

Stop

systemctl stop mysqld.service

Restart

systemctl restart mysqld.service

Check if MySQL is running

systemctl is-active mysqld.service
  • 0 Users Found This Useful
Was this answer helpful?

Related Articles

How To Add Date and Time To Bash History

As Linux users and engineers, we often have to look back in our bash history to figure out...

Setup vsftp with SELinux

Howto Setup vsftp with SELinux Vsftpd is a fast and secure FTP server. Installing an FTP...

Install Apache Web Server Centos 7

Install Apache Web Server on Centos 7 The Apache HTTP Server Project is an effort to...

MySQL - Check Which Query is Consuming Resources

MySQL - Checking Which Query is Consuming Resources Have you ever wondered which mysql query...

How to extract a tar.gz file

So you have went to that website and downloaded the latest version of your files. But they are in...